Função ClfsSetArchiveTail (wdm.h)
A rotina ClfsSetArchiveTail define a parte final do arquivo de um log CLFS como um LSN especificado.
Sintaxe
CLFSUSER_API NTSTATUS ClfsSetArchiveTail(
[in] PLOG_FILE_OBJECT plfoLog,
[in] PCLFS_LSN plsnArchiveTail
);
Parâmetros
[in] plfoLog
Um ponteiro para uma estrutura de LOG_FILE_OBJECT que representa um log CLFS. O chamador obteve esse ponteiro anteriormente chamando ClfsCreateLogFile.
[in] plsnArchiveTail
Um ponteiro para uma estrutura de CLFS_LSN que especifica o LSN que deve se tornar a nova parte final do arquivo morto. Esse deve ser o LSN exato de um registro no log.
Valor de retorno
ClfsSetArchiveTail retornará STATUS_SUCCESS se tiver êxito; caso contrário, ele retorna um dos códigos de erro definidos em Ntstatus.h.
Observações
O valor plsnArchiveTail especifica onde o arquivamento começa no log. O próximo arquivamento começará em ou antes de este LSN.
Para obter uma explicação dos conceitos e terminologia do CLFS, consulte Common Log File System.
Requisitos
Requisito | Valor |
---|---|
de cliente com suporte mínimo | Disponível no Windows Server 2003 R2, Windows Vista e versões posteriores do Windows. |
da Plataforma de Destino | Área de trabalho |
cabeçalho | wdm.h (inclua Wdm.h) |
biblioteca | Clfs.lib |
de DLL | Clfs.sys |
IRQL | <= APC_LEVEL |